If you ever wondered just how transparent the 3M ScotchCal product (marketed by InvincaShield, Amorfriend and others as computer cut kits) would look on your TT, look very closely at YOUR door handle. A small piece of what I assume to be the same stuff is applied to the outside door handle of TTs to prevent scratches from rings, etc.<p><img SRC="http://www.mint.net/~kentech/auditt/ttsig.jpg" BORDER=0>

Interesting. On mine I see a verty fine line, at top and bottom, similar to a paint masking line that runs horizontally along each outside door handle. At close inspection, I am certain that what I am seeing is the 3M film. VW also uses this film on the Passat rear wheel flare, standard. My TT is a 180FWD, purchased in late June 99. Maybe thay dropped it on the Quattros.
